Jobs for Alternative Medical Support Grads in Texas

In this state, there are 980 people employed in jobs related to an alternative medical support degree, compared to 36,680 nationwide.

Wages for Alternative Medical Support Jobs in Texas

A typical salary for a alternative medical support grad in the state is $70,270, compared to a typical salary of $85,600 nationwide.
